Last Listing description (July 2024)

Set back from the street on an elevated, surprisingly large 181sqm block in one of Zetland's most peaceful and sought-after pockets, this charming cottage offers comfortable family living, excellent convenience and incredible promise. Currently configured as a three-bedroom home, the property, which boasts dual street entry, has immense potential with approved plans for a spacious architectural three-bedroom home with secured parking. Bustling Green Square restaurants, shops and train station lie within 400 metres of this superb offering, and the popular Gunyama Park Aquatic and Recreation Centre is just 350 metres away.

- Large Federation-era block with classic dual level three-bedroom house
- Generous separate living room, neat and bright gas dine-in kitchen

- Luminous main bedroom with tiled ensuite and generous built-in robe
- Tidy bathroom with separate w/c, plus good-sized internal laundry
- Gorgeously sunny paved rear courtyard opens onto Macpherson Lane
- Wide front porch and level lawn, timber floorboards, French windows
- East Village Shopping Centre & Green square Station both 650m & Mary O'Brien Reserve just 100m
- DA approved for a car space

About Zetland 2017

The size of Zetland is approximately 0.8 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 6.2% of total area. The population of Zetland in 2011 was 3,812 people. By 2016 the population was 10,079 showing a population growth of 164.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Zetland is 20-29 years. Households in Zetland are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Zetland work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 50.1% of the homes in Zetland were owner-occupied compared with 34.3% in 2016.

Zetland has 9,024 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Zetland have seen a 50.85%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 16.07%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Zetland is $2,109,239 while the median value for Units is $1,039,936.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,035 while Units have a median rent of $995.
There are currently 60 properties listed for sale, and 56 properties listed for rent in Zetland on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 464 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Zetland.
